Bio
CSUN - 2024 (Senior)
Rosten appeared in 15 games, starting in one of them… Accumulated 389 minutes…Totaled five shots with three of them being on goal…Played a season high 46 minutes against Sacramento St (10/16)
CSUN - 2023 (Junior)
Rosten competed in 11 matches in his first season with CSUN ... totaled four shots with three on goal ... finished with 187 minutes played on the season ... saw a season-high 31 minutes vs. Cal State Bakersfield (9/30/23).
PRIOR TO CSUN
Named 2022 United Soccer Coaches Division III Junior College Player of the Year and 2022 United Soccer Coaches Division III first-team All-American after leading Oxnard College to the CCCAA Championship … was chosen CCCAA Tournament MVP after scoring both goals in the 2-1 championship game victory over Mt SAC … posted 11 goals and eight assists in 23 appearances (all starts) as a sophomore on his way to earning first-team All-Conference honors … Oxnard won the 2022 Western State Conference title …. played in 12 matches, started 10 times as a freshman … scored twice, and had two assists.
HIGH SCHOOL
A 2020 graduate of St. Bonaventure High School … named first-team All-League three times … chose first-team All-County as a junior and as a senior … named Tri-Valley League MVP as a senior after scoring 40 goals and recording six assists … the team won the Tri-Valley League title in 2020 … CLUB EXPERIENCE: Played for Oaks FC.
